Chase is an American national bank that offers consumer and commercial banking services. They provide debit and credit cards for easy transactions, which can be managed through the Chase Mobile app or their website. The company sends SMS messages to customers as a form of verification code when logging in from new devices or locations, ensuring account security. Additionally, they send alerts regarding re-verification requirements via email with links leading to their official site at chasesite.com.
